Introduction

Agricultural chemicals such as pesticides, herbicides, and fertilizers often require reliable packaging solutions to maintain product quality during storage and transportation.

However, temperature changes, altitude variations, and chemical reactions inside containers can create pressure differences. Without proper ventilation, plastic containers may expand, collapse, or develop leakage problems.

How Does a Vent Plug Work?

A vent plug combines a protective housing with a microporous vent membrane.

The core component is usually an ePTFE (expanded polytetrafluoroethylene) membrane, which has millions of microscopic pores.

The membrane allows:

✓ Air molecules to pass through
✓ Internal pressure to equalize
✓ Gas release from the container

At the same time, it blocks:

✓ Water penetration
✓ Liquid leakage
✓ External contaminants

This structure creates a waterproof and breathable packaging system.

Key Benefits of ePTFE Vent Plugs

1. Pressure Equalization

During transportation, containers may experience temperature and altitude changes.

A sealed bottle can create vacuum or positive pressure conditions.

A press fit vent plug allows controlled airflow, reducing the risk of:

  • Container expansion
  • Container collapse
  • Cap deformation

2. Leak Protection

Agrochemical liquids may contain surfactants and other chemical additives.

Standard ventilation materials may lose performance after long-term contact with chemicals.

High-performance ePTFE membranes provide:

  • Excellent chemical resistance
  • Low liquid penetration risk
  • Stable ventilation performance

3. Waterproof Venting Performance

A high-quality waterproof vent plug must achieve two opposite functions:

  • Allow gas exchange
  • Prevent liquid entry

The hydrophobic structure of ePTFE membranes provides strong water resistance while maintaining airflow.

Vent Plug Design for Different Packaging Sizes

Different container volumes require different airflow capacities.

For example:

Small Containers

Small pesticide bottles often use:

  • Vent liners
  • Induction venting solutions

These designs are suitable for compact packaging.


Large Containers

Containers above several liters usually require:

  • Plastic vent plugs
  • Snap-in vents
  • Press-fit vent solutions

These products provide higher airflow capacity and easier installation.

Plastic Vent Plug Manufacturing Options

A professional vent plug usually consists of:

Vent Membrane

Material:

  • ePTFE membrane
  • Oleophobic treatment options

Function:

  • Waterproof breathable performance
  • Chemical resistance

Plastic Housing

Common materials:

  • PP
  • HDPE

Manufacturing methods:

  • Ultrasonic welding
  • Thermal bonding
  • Injection molding integration

This integrated structure improves sealing reliability and product consistency.

How to Choose the Right Vent Plug?

When selecting a vent plug, consider:

1. Container Volume

Larger containers require higher airflow rates.

2. Chemical Compatibility

The membrane should resist:

  • Surfactants
  • Oils
  • Corrosive liquids

3. Installation Method

Options include:

  • Press fit vent
  • Snap-in vent
  • Welded vent assembly

4. Environmental Conditions

Consider:

  • Temperature changes
  • Transportation distance
  • Storage conditions
